ON Semiconductor has announced that its image sensing and LiDAR technologies power key functions of AutoX Gen5 self-driving platform. Revealed at the World Artificial Intelligence Conference, the new Gen5 autonomous vehicle technology enables the first fully driverless RoboTaxi, designed to democratise autonomy and provide universal access to the transportation of people and goods. “In our quest to bring our Level 4 autonomous RoboTaxi to the market, ON Semiconductor is the obvious partner for all of our sensing needs,” stated Jianxiong Xiao, Founder and CEO of AutoX.
